  • Under the supervision of the Registered Nurse / Registered Midwife, contribute to the overall planning and

delivery of nursing/midwifery care for patients ensuring a patient cantered approach to care.

  • Under the direction of the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ife, assist in the activities of daily living for

patients in accordance with the patient care plan e.g. distribution of patient meals and assisting patients with

hygiene needs.

  • Maintain a high standard of nursing/midwifery care for patients, working within evidence-based guidelines

and unit specific competencies.

  • Demonstrate service excellence and act as a patient advocate to support the patients’ dignity and rights at

all times.

  • Ensure the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ife is informed of vital sign observations and care provided for

patients and document appropriately.

  • Observe and report changes in the patient’s condition and reactions to different aspects of care to a

Registered Nurse/Registered Midwife immediately.

  • Respond to emergencies according to the organization’s policies and procedures
  • Facilitate post discharge clinic visits and/or tests as required including scheduling follow-up and referral

appointments

  • Help arrange patient transportation as required.
  • Maintain flow of documents for scanning if needed.
  • Provide direct patient care according to the therapeutic plan and individual patient needs as directed by the

patient care plan under supervision of a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ife.

  • Provide appropriate information to assist the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ife, in the preparation and

maintenance of an effective patient care plan.

  • Record in the patient’s official record a detailed report of care given which reflects the therapeutic plan and

specific aspects of the patient care plan under direction of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ife.

  • Reinforce instructions given to the patient by the physician and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ife, and

refers new needs for instruction to the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ife.

· Initiate emergency assistance as per policies and procedures and perform Basic Life Support as per regulatory requirements and scope.

· Perform other duties as assigned by the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ife, and within the scope of practice · Ask questions when in doubt for clarification by the Registered Nurse/ Registered Midwife.

· Escalate to and seek expert advice from colleagues when unable to or not competent to undertake required care.

Essential: the post holder must

  • Have an appropriate license to work as an assistant nurse/assistant midwife in the relevant regulatory health

authority with all the qualification and experience these mandates.

  • Manage their own professional re-licensure.
  • Hold a valid American Heart Association Basic Life Support Provider card.
  • Be willing to work across departments when necessary
  • Be able to communicate clearly and effectively in English (spoken and written)

DESIRABLE: The post holder should have:

  • Evidenced ability to work as part of an inter-professional team
  • Organizational and administrative skills with which to use the electronic medical record platform for clinical

documentation

  • Be able to communicate effectively in Arabic
